2016-05-19 4 views
0

私はSpring Tool SuiteでMavenを使用しています。 しばらくしてから、スプリングライブラリのインポートをもう解決できませんでした。Mavenは依存関係のロードを停止しました

enter image description here

輸入org.springframework.jdbc.core.JdbcTemplateは は、私はMavenのが問題になると思います

を解決することはできません。しかし、私は理由を知らない。 他のすべてのインポートは引き続き機能しています。

のpom.xml

<project xmlns="http://maven.apache.org/POM/4.0.0" x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xsi:schemaLocation="http://maven.apache.org/POM/4.0.0 http://maven.apache.org/xsd/maven-4.0.0.xsd"> 
    <modelVersion>4.0.0</modelVersion> 
    <groupId>DatabaseProject</groupId> 
    <artifactId>DatabaseProject</artifactId> 
    <version>0.0.1-SNAPSHOT</version> 
    <packaging>war</packaging> 
    <build> 
    <plugins> 
     <plugin> 
     <artifactId>maven-compiler-plugin</artifactId> 
     <version>3.3</version> 
     <configuration> 
      <source>1.8</source> 
      <target>1.8</target> 
     </configuration> 
     </plugin> 
     <plugin> 
     <artifactId>maven-war-plugin</artifactId> 
     <version>2.6</version> 
     <configuration> 
      <warSourceDirectory>WebContent</warSourceDirectory> 
      <failOnMissingWebXml>false</failOnMissingWebXml> 
     </configuration> 
     </plugin> 
    </plugins> 
    </build> 

    <dependencies> 
    <dependency> 
     <groupId>org.springframework</groupId> 
     <artifactId>spring-context</artifactId> 
     <version>4.2.6.RELEASE</version> 
     <scope>compile</scope> 
    </dependency> 
    <dependency> 
     <groupId>org.springframework</groupId> 
     <artifactId>spring-core</artifactId> 
     <version>4.2.6.RELEASE</version> 
     <scope>compile</scope> 
    </dependency> 
    <dependency> 
     <groupId>org.springframework</groupId> 
     <artifactId>spring-web</artifactId> 
     <version>4.2.6.RELEASE</version> 
     <scope>compile</scope> 
    </dependency> 
    <dependency> 
     <groupId>org.springframework</groupId> 
     <artifactId>spring-webmvc</artifactId> 
     <version>4.2.6.RELEASE</version> 
     <scope>compile</scope> 
    </dependency> 
    <dependency> 
     <groupId>org.springframework</groupId> 
     <artifactId>spring-aspects</artifactId> 
     <version>4.2.6.RELEASE</version> 
     <scope>compile</scope> 
    </dependency> 
    <dependency> 
     <groupId>org.springframework</groupId> 
     <artifactId>spring-jdbc</artifactId> 
     <version>4.2.6.RELEASE</version> 
    </dependency> 
    <dependency> 
     <groupId>mysql</groupId> 
     <artifactId>mysql-connector-java</artifactId> 
     <version>6.0.2</version> 
    </dependency> 
    <dependency> 
     <groupId>org.springframework</groupId> 
     <artifactId>spring-tx</artifactId> 
     <version>4.2.6.RELEASE</version> 
    </dependency> 


</dependencies> 

</project> 
+0

を更新するAlt+F5を押して? – coder

+0

プロジェクトをクリーンアップして修正できますか? – ryekayo

+0

Eclipseの場合は、「Maven-> Update Project」が役立つことがあります。 – Berger

答えて

0

問題は達人の構成に関連することができます。

プロキシを導入した企業で働いている場合、正しく構成されていないと、mavenを終了できません。

以前に依存関係がダウンロードされていた場合、mavenはローカルバージョンの依存関係を取るため問題はありませんが、新しい依存関係を使用しようとするとプロジェクト内に新しいjarが表示されません。

0

は、最後に私の仕事:

Right Click on Project -> Maven -> Update Project 
0

をSTSプロジェクトエクスプローラで、プロジェクトを選択し、MVN作品をクリーンインストールしたか失敗したのmaven

関連する問題